Kale Frittata

Made with six simple ingredients in just over 30 minutes, this Kale Frittata is a great make-ahead breakfast, brunch, or dinner. Customize it with various mix-ins and toppings, and enjoy it any time of day!

Frittatas are a family favorite option in my home and one of my favorite ways to get my little ones to eat different veggies. This kale frittata recipe is a particular favorite for spring, allowing me to take advantage of in-season produce. Even better, the rich flavor is so delicious that my kids don’t even realize I sneak in kale.

With 9 servings per frittata, it’s perfect for hosting a crowd, and I love to store leftovers for a packed lunch the next day. Don’t worry if you’ve never attempted a frittata at home, either. With my simple steps, you’re guaranteed to have success!

Ingredients:
  • 1 bunch curly leaf kale
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t, divided
  • 8 large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ons milk (any kind)
  • 4 ounces cheese, any type, grated or crumbled (try grated sharp cheddar, crumbled feta, or goat cheese)
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
25 minutes
Total Time:
40 minutes
